The Pitiless Drosera

But lo! What creature to my clutches wings
Attracted by fallacious promises
And curious to taste my sweet delights?
My scarlet beauty fashioned to bewilder
Shall tantalize this unsuspecting prey
And cause the wretch to plunge into my depths.
I’ll  suck him to a vortex of despair
And suffocate by my tenacious grasp,
Then ruthlessly eviscerate; 
For by such means survival is procured.



( In case anyone is worried about my state of mind : 'Drosera', commonly known as the sundews, is one of the largest genera of carnivorous plants!)

Pitiless Power

Horrendous wind, driving rain,
this is the approaching hurricane.
They give them names these storms,
to make them like a woman scorned.
They drive across the oceans so wide,
gathering strength for the shores they collide.
Hitting the land like a hammer hits glass,
People hiding, waiting and hoping it will pass.
Boats in the harbors homes by the shore,
take all the hatred, it shakes to the core.
All smashed to oblivion as havoc is wreaked,
Then folk from their shelters start to creep,
To find if there's anything left to keep.
Homes demolished, cars beyond repair,
people can only show a look of despair.
Trying to salvage whatever they may,
from the devastation the storm left today.
They live in the path called hurricane alley.
Nowhere else to go so they hope for the best,
Next year the storms may  give them a rest.
